What is the formula of the compound made when sodium reacts with fluorine?

The compound formed when sodium reacts with fluorine is sodium fluoride, with the chemical formula NaF. Sodium donates one electron to fluorine to form an ionic bond between the two elements.

In the periodic table what is NaF?

NaF is the chemical formula for sodium fluoride. It is a compound formed by the combination of sodium (Na) and fluorine (F) atoms. Sodium fluoride is commonly used in toothpaste and water fluoridation to prevent tooth decay.


What sodium compound makes bromine?

Bromine is an element and can't be "made" from any other element (except by a nuclear reaction). However, since the question asks for a sodium compound, one possibility is sodium bromide, which can be melted and electrolyzed to form bromine at the anode.


What is an ionic compound made from the neutralization of an acid with a base?

A salt. Explanation example: HCl + NaOH --> H2O + NaCl Hydrogen chloride reacts with sodium hydroxide to produce water and sodium chloride where sodium chloride is the salt.

Is oxygen and fluorine a molecular compound?

Yes, oxygen and fluorine can form a molecular compound called oxygen difluoride (OF2). This compound is made up of one oxygen atom and two fluorine atoms bonded together.

Salt is what type of compound?

Salt is a crystallized ionic compound made from sodium and chloride ions. It is a dietary mineral which is called sodium chloride in totality. It results from ionic bonds between the positive (sodium-Na) and negative (chloride-Cl) ions called cations and anions respectively.
